The Participation of Women in the Life and Leadership of the Church.
On March 10th Study Group 5 published it’s final report on this topic. You’ll remember the study group was one of many, created as part of the Synod of Bishops on synodality. Study Group 5 was tasked with examining women's participation in the life and leadership of the church.
